PODCAST | The Way Forward for the Knowledge Economy and the Educational Sector in Lebanon
- Bassel Akar, Lina S. Maddah
Economist Lina Maddah and education specialist Bassel Akar discuss with Christelle Barakat the state of the knowledge economy and education sector in Lebanon, pinpointing the key challenges and offering solutions to overcome them.
Lina S. Maddah is an Economic Researcher at the Lebanese Center for Policy Studies (LCPS) and a Lecturer in the Department of Economics at the Lebanese American University (LAU), Lebanon.
Bassel Akar is a Research Associate at the Center for Applied Research at Notre Dame University (NDU) - Louaize, Lebanon, and at the Center of African Studies at the University of Porto, Portugal.
